I've never encountered anything like this before. The printer seems insisstent on A4 paper as default. I've gone into all the printer settings themselves, and they are set to US standard letter paper. I've gone repeatedly into System Settings>Printers and set the paper size, but the next time I open System Settings, the paper has reverted to A4. When I try to print something, it will print on the letter-size paper I have loaded, but not before asking me if it's all right to do that. Bottom line: I can print, but it's an unnecessary nuisance. Any ideas?

Check your region settings to make sure it is what you need it to be set to.
While my printer does seem to store the desired paper size, the specific applications may be requesting a different one. I have my PC location set to the US mainly as my workplace is still the US and it is just easier to manage things that way, so until I changed the regional setting for paper size, some things would still want to use Letter even though I need to use A4.
Libreoffice in particular seems to have their own print settings separate from whatever the locale is.
